Where is the Vansmith family from?

You can see how Vansmith families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Vansmith family name was found in the USA, and Scotland between 1871 and 1920. The most Vansmith families were found in Scotland in 1871. In 1871 there were 5 Vansmith families living in Stirlingshire. This was 100% of all the recorded Vansmith's in Scotland. Stirlingshire had the highest population of Vansmith families in 1871.
